数据异常:为什么你的详情页在搜索结果中消失了?

当你在 Google Search Console 后台看到“已发现 - 当前未收录”的页面数量激增时,这通常意味着搜索引擎蜘蛛在抓取你的详情页时陷入了死循环。很多运营者迷信外链,但如果页面的 LCP(最大内容绘制)超过 2.5 秒,或者核心商品信息依赖于异步 JS 请求,蜘蛛根本不会等待你的接口返回数据,直接判定为空白页面。

H2 逻辑重构:从 DOM 结构到结构化数据植入

老手在处理详情页时,第一步不是改文案,而是看源码。必须确保 H1 标签唯一且包含核心商品词,并且商品的 Price 和 Availability 信息必须通过 JSON-LD 结构化数据 直接嵌入到 HTML 中,而不是等页面加载后再渲染。

  • 语义化标签:禁止通篇 <div>,商品描述必须封装在 <article> 标签内。
  • 图片预加载:针对首屏主图(Hero Image),通过 <link rel="preload"> 强制浏览器加速解析,避免布局偏移导致的 CLS 扣分。
  • 剔除无效代码:检查并删除页面内无用的第三方追踪像素(如没有在投放却开启的 Pinterest Tag),这些脚本通常会拖慢 300ms 以上的解析时间。

H2 实操方案:首屏渲染与 CDN 边缘缓存配置

直接拉到服务器配置层面。很多电商站点的响应慢是因为每一次访问都在实时查询数据库。建议在 Nginx 层面实施 Micro-caching 策略。具体的参数范围建议如下表:

优化维度 技术参数标准 预期收益
TTFB (首字节耗时) < 200ms 蜘蛛抓取频次提升 30%
FCP (首屏加载) < 1.2s 跳出率降低 15%
图片格式 WebP (Lossless) 带宽成本降低 40%

关键细节:利用懒加载阈值控制流量

不要全量开启懒加载。首屏前两张图必须设置为“loading="eager"”,而首屏以下的图使用 loading="lazy",并设置 rootMargin 为 200px。这样做能保证用户滚动前图片已就绪,同时不占用首屏宝贵的连接数。

H2 风险与避坑:警惕 JS 渲染陷阱

很多现代电商框架(如 React/Next.js)默认采用客户端渲染,这对 SEO 是致命的。老手的判断依据很简单:禁用浏览器 JS 后刷新页面,如果商品价格和描述消失了,那你的 SEO 就已经废了一半。务必开启 SSR(服务端渲染)或预渲染(Static Site Generation)。

H2 验证指标:如何判断优化生效?

优化上线 48 小时后,关注两个硬指标:一是 GSC 中的“索引编制状态”是否有上扬趋势;二是 Chrome DevTools 性能面板中的 LCP 关键路径 是否不再被 JS 脚本阻塞。如果这两个指标没动,说明你的 CDN 缓存没刷新,或者 HTML 模板中存在循环重定向。